Market Definition & Overview
The AI X-Ray Analytics Market encompasses advanced software solutions and platforms le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ms to interpret medical X-ray images. This market provides tools that assist radiologists and clinicians in automated detection, characterization, and quantification of various pathologies, abnormalities, and conditions across anatomical regions such as the chest, musculoskeletal system, and abdomen. These AI-powered applications aim to enhance diagnostic accuracy, reduce interpretation time, improve clinical workflow efficiency, and support more informed treatment decisions. It includes products for identifying conditions like pneumonia, tuberculosis, fractures, and lung nodules, primarily adopted in hospitals, diagnostic imaging centers, and specialized clinics globally.

Inclusions
- AI-powered software for chest X-ray interpretation.
- Machine learning algorithms for fracture detection and bone age assessment.
- Cloud-based and on-premise AI platforms for X-ray image processing.
- Diagnostic support tools for detecting lung nodules, pneumonia, and cardiomegaly.
- AI modules integrated into existing PACS/RIS for X-ray workflow optimization.
- AI solutions for identifying skeletal abnormalities and degenerative changes.
Exclusions
- Traditional X-ray imaging hardware and equipment.
- AI solutions for other medical imaging modalities (e.g., MRI, CT, ultrasound).
- General medical AI software not specific to X-ray analysis.
- Radiology Information Systems (RIS) or Picture Archiving and Communication Systems (PACS) without integrated AI.
- Research-only AI algorithms not cleared for clinical diagnostic use.

Market Dynamics
Market Trends
- Growing adoption of AI for early disease detection and screening.
- Increasing integration of AI solutions with existing PACS systems.
- Shift towards cloud-based AI platforms for scalability and access.
- Emphasis on explainable AI to build clinician trust and acceptance.
Growth Drivers
- Rising prevalence of chronic and respiratory diseases requiring diagnostics.
- Shortage of skilled radiologists worldwide drives demand for AI assistance.
- Need for faster, more accurate diagnostic results reduces human error.
- Technological advancements in deep learning and image processing.
Restraints
- High implementation costs limit adoption, especially for smaller facilities.
- Complex regulatory pathways delay market entry and product deployment.
- Data privacy and security concerns remain significant hurdles for widespread use.
- Integration with existing hospital IT systems poses technical challenges.
Opportunities
- Expansion into emerging economies with less access to specialist radiologists.
- Developing AI for new imaging modalities beyond traditional X-rays.
- Partnerships with medical device manufacturers for integrated solutions.
- AI for personalized medicine and treatment planning based on imaging.

Competitive Landscape
| # | Company | Share | Key Strategy | Key Note | Key Developments | Key Products |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Aidoc | 5.7% | Focus on comprehensive AI solutions that integrate deeply into radiology workflows for high impact across various pathologies. | One of the most widely adopted AI platforms in radiology, covering a broad spectrum of acute and non-acute conditions. | Continuously expanding its FDA-cleared and CE-marked solutions, regularly adding new algorithms for critical findings. | Aidoc AI PlatformaiWITNESSaiRAD+1 |
| 2 | Lunit | 5.4% | Develop precise AI solutions for cancer detection and treatment, leveraging deep learning for both diagnostic imaging and pathology. | Known for its strong scientific publications and clinical validation in both oncology imaging and digital pathology. | Partnered with various global medical device companies and pharmaceutical firms to integrate its AI solutions. | Lunit INSIGHT CXRLunit INSIGHT MMGLunit INSIGHT DBT+1 |
| 3 | Qure.ai | 5.1% | Provide affordable and accessible AI solutions for rapid diagnosis in radiology, particularly focusing on high-burden diseases and underserved markets. | Emphasizes deployment in diverse clinical settings, including emergency rooms and public health screening programs, globally. | Collaborated with public health initiatives and governments to deploy its AI for tuberculosis and lung cancer screening. | qXRqCTqER+1 |
| 4 | VUNO Inc. | 4.9% | Create comprehensive AI medical solutions across various specialties, integrating AI into clinical practice for efficiency and accuracy. | A pioneer in South Korea's medical AI landscape with a diverse portfolio extending beyond X-ray analytics to other imaging modalities and bio-signals. | Received regulatory clearances in multiple international markets and secured strategic investments to expand its global footprint. | VUNO Med-CXR AIVUNO Med-BoneAgeVUNO Med-Fundus AI+1 |
| 5 | Imagen Technologies | 4.6% | Focus on AI-powered diagnostic tools for orthopedic and musculoskeletal conditions, aiming to improve early detection and reduce diagnostic errors. | Its flagship product, OsteoDetect, was one of the first FDA-cleared AI solutions for wrist fracture detection. | Expanded its AI capabilities to detect additional musculoskeletal conditions, moving beyond initial fracture detection. | OsteoDetectOrthoDetectMusculoskeletal AI |
